CHHATTISGARH HIGH COURT
Goutam Bhaduri, J
Nanaki alias Shyam Lal Patel v. State of Chhattisgarh

1. This criminal appeal preferred by the appellant herein under S.374(2) of the CrPC is directed against the impugned judgment dated 11.1.2011 passed by the 2 Additional Sessions Judge, Bilaspur, in Sessions Trial No.7/2010, by which the appellant has been convicted for offence under S.201 of the IPC and sentenced to undergo rigorous imprisonment for seven years and further directed to pay fine of Rs.2000 / , in default of payment of fine, to further undergo rigorous imprisonment for five months.
